#03b648 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#03b648 is composed of 1.2% red, 71.4%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.4%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 143.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 36.3%. #03b648 color hex could be obtained by blending #06ff90 with #006d00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#03b648 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#03b648 has RGB values of R:3, G:182,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 243272.

Shades and Tints of #03b648
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000803 is the darkest color, while #f4fff8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#03b648
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#58615c is the less saturated color, while #03b648 is the most saturated one.
